Which element has the greatest impact on the development of a story?a setting b characters c rising actiond falling action

English
1 answer:
shusha [124]3 years ago
6 0
B. The character have the biggest impact because their actions can change the course of where the story is going such as in my example, you have a boy who is running for school president. The boy then gets into a fight and is suspended, he can no longer run for president at his school as a punishment for getting into the fight. His action of fighting changed the story's course.
